Investigation On The Mental Health Of Students In A Secondary Vocational College And The Effect Of Internet-delivered Cognitive Behavior Therapy On Depression

Objective: To investigate the mental health of students in a secondary vocational school in Guiyang,to treat the individual who meets the criteria of depression diagnosis,and to explore the effect of Internet-delivered cognitive behavior therapy(ICBT)on the adolescent depression patients.Methods: Investigated the mental health of students in a secondary vocational college in Guiyang,SCID was used to interviews individuals with depression tendency.Those who meet the DSM-IV diagnostic criteria for depression are treated.They were randomly divided into control group and study group.The control group was treated with sertraline.The study group was treated with ICBT combined with sertraline.HAMD-17 and HAMA were evaluated baseline period,4 weeks and 8 weeks.APGAR,GSES and SCSQ were assessed during baseline period treatment and 8 weeks.The efficacy of ICBT was evaluated according to the evaluation results.Results:(1)A total of 1621 questionnaires were sent out,and 1514 valid questionnaires were returned(the effective response rate was 93.3%).The results showed that 404 people(26.7%)had a total score of SCL-90 > 160,and 513 people(33.9%)had more than 43 positive items;The scores of somatization,obsessive-compulsive symptoms,depression,anxiety,interpersonal sensitivity,phobia and other factors in SCL-90 of female students were higher than those of male students(P<0.01).843 people(55.7%)had a total SDS score of 41 or above.459 people participated in the SCID interview,and 88 of them met the diagnostic criteria of depressive disorder.(2)The control group(18 people,5 people shed at the end of 8 weeks)and the study group(19 people,4 people shed at the end of 8weeks).After 8 weeks of treatment,the scores of HAMD-17 in the study group and the control group were significantly decreased(F=78.24,P<0.01;F=60.83,P<0.01);There was significant difference in HAMD-17 score reduction rate between the two groups(t=3.74,P<0.01).After 8 weeks of treatment,HAMA scores of study group and control group were significantly decreased(F=31.55,P<0.01;F=34.19,P<0.01).There was a significant difference in the reduction rate of HAMA score between the study group and the control group(t=4.52,P<0.01).After 8 weeks,there was significant difference in APGAR score between the two groups(t=2.48,P<0.05).After 8 weeks,there was no significant difference in GSES reduction between the study group and the control group(t=1.89,P>0.05).At the end of the 8th week,the score of positive coping style in the study group was higher than that in the baseline period,and the difference was statistically significant(t=-4.01,P<0.01);There was no significant difference in the score of negative coping style between the study group and the baseline at the end of 8 weeks(t=0.03,P>0.05);There was no significant difference in the scores of positive coping style and negative coping style between the two groups(t=0.44,P>0.05;t=-0.23,P>0.05).Conclusion:(1)The level of mental health of students in a secondary vocational school in Guiyang is low,and the detection rate of depression is high.It is necessary to pay attention to strengthen mental health education and relieve students’ mental health problems.(2)ICBT combined with drugs can improve the depression and anxiety of adolescent patients with depressive disorder,which is better than drugs alone;ICBT can improve the family function and positive coping style of adolescent patients with depressive disorder.
